Abstract

The utility model comprises a power source, a crystal oscillation circuit, a frequency dividing circuit, a second display circuit, a second display lamp group, a minute pulse circuit, a minute display circuit, a minute display lamp group, an hour display circuit, an hour display lamp group, a timer, a fiber group, a lamp display dial and a nighttime time-stamping lamp group. The utility model displays hours minutes and seconds by the lamp and the optical fiber, is composed of electronic circuit, and doesn't have moving parts and reduces failure probability. The utility model has the advantages of accurate and reliable timekeeping, long service life, simple structure and low cost; besides the utility model can be wristwatch, and can also be large bells for public place and household bells.

Light display quartz clocks and watches
The utility model belongs to the electric time-keeping technical field.
Present pointer quartz clock and watch drive pointer with synchronous motor by mechanical driving device.Because the existence activity is partly, the structure more complicated, energy consumption is bigger, has increased the possibility that produces fault.
The purpose of this utility model is to provide a kind of movable quartz clock partly that do not have fully, and these clock and watch take turns the shinny demonstration time with lamp on the dial plate and optical fiber.
The utility model comprises power supply 1, crystal oscillation circuit 2, frequency dividing circuit 3, second display circuit 4, second display lamp group 5, divide pulse circuit 6, divide display circuit 7, divide display lamp group 8, the time display circuit 9, the time display lamp group 10, chronopher 11, optical fibre set 12, light shows dial plate 13, and night, timestamp lamp group 14.Fig. 1 is its structural drawing.Power supply 1 output DC is pressed to each partly power supply, can adopt the stabilized voltage supply of alternating current after rectification, also can adopt battery.Light shows 12 of timestamp lamp groups at night is housed on the dial plate 13, the time 24 of display lamp groups, divide 60 of display lamp groups, second, the display lamp group was 60, and these four groups of lamp banks become concentric circles, and ecto-entad is arranged in order, as shown in Figure 2, lamp can adopt incandescent lamp, gas-discharge lamp, also can adopt LED.Crystal oscillation circuit 2 is that oscillation source produces vibration with the quartz crystal, and through frequency dividing circuit 3 frequency divisions, output 1Hz pulse signal is as pps pulse per second signal.Pps pulse per second signal one tunnel input second display circuit 4,60 pulse signals of display circuit 4 per minutes output second are to a second display lamp group 5,60 lamps in second display lamp group promptly ignite in turn, to indicate second, second display lamp 5 also can be with 1 lamp, the 1Hz pulse signal that input frequency dividing circuit 3 produces makes its per minute glittering 60 times; Another road input of pps pulse per second signal divides pulse circuit 6, dividing pulse circuit 6 is 60 system circuit, 60 pps pulse per second signals of every input, promptly produce 1 branch pulse signal, export branch display circuit 7 to, display circuit 7 was exported 60 branch pulse signals to dividing display lamp group 8 in 1 hour, 60 lamps in the branch display lamp group 8 are ignited in turn, divided with indication.Divide display circuit 7 every 1 pulse of output in 30 minutes to the time display circuit 9, the time display circuit 9 outputs in per 12 hours 24 pulse signals to the time display lamp group 10,24 lamps when making in the display lamp group 10 ignite in turn, with indication hour.Show on the dial plate 13 at light, optical fibre set 12 also is housed, optical fibre set 12 has 60 optical fiber, be arranged on the card by radial, as shown in Figure 2, every optical fiber is conical, surface working becomes the inclined-plane of pointer shape, and the thin end of optical fiber is towards the card center of circle, and distal end joins with dividing display lamp 8, shown in Fig. 3 (a), as a minute pointer, 24 optical fiber wherein simultaneously with minute display lamp and the time display lamp join, shown in Fig. 3 (b), both made the branch pointer, pointer when doing again.Light shows the outmost turns of dial plate 13, also be equipped with form by 12 lamps night Chang Liang timestamp lamp group 14 at night.Divide the pulse of display circuit 7, also import chronopher 11 simultaneously, made give the correct time in its per 1 hour 1 time every output in 1 hour.
The utility model has the advantages that do not have movable partly, therefore can simplified structure, it is little to consume energy, the possibility that breaks down is little, accurate timing, the reliability height, the life-span is long, cost is low.Of many uses, both can make wrist-watch, also can make the huge clock of home-use clock and public place.
